Cash in Your Unclaimed Property

Who wouldn’t want some extra money in their pocket, especially if it’s money they didn’t know they had?

The California State Controller’s Office safeguards millions of dollars that belong to residents who for one reason or another don't know they have that money. In a majority of cases, much of the money comes from forgotten bank accounts, bank accounts that were closed and still held money, checks that were never cashed or insurance policies.

There is no deadline for claiming the money once it is transferred over to the controller’s office.

Those wishing to check if they are owed some cash can search the state controller’s website by inputting some basic data, including first and last names.

Any money that is owed can be reclaimed on the site following the posted instructions and in a few weeks a check will be mailed out.
